This operator's manual covers the Case Ingersoll 220, 222, 224, and 444 Series tractors, a line of durable and versatile heavy-duty garden and utility tractors primarily produced in the 1970s and 1980s. These tractors are known for their robust engineering and reliability, featuring gasoline, air-cooled engines, hydrostatic transmissions, and shaft drive systems. They were designed for a wide range of tasks, reflecting a heritage of quality in agricultural and construction equipment. This manual covers the Case IH Magnum Series Tractors, specifically the MX Magnum models 180, 200, 220, 240, and 270. These heavy-duty agricultural tractors were produced in the late 1990s and early to mid-2000s, designed for high horsepower applications and demanding farm operations. Known for their robust powertrain, advanced hydraulics, and operator comfort features such as a spacious, quiet cab and ergonomic controls, the MX Magnum series built upon Case IH's long legacy in agricultural machinery. They represent a significant advancement in tractor technology, offering powerful performance and integrated features for efficient farming.

The Case Ingersoll 200 Series Garden Tractor, encompassing models 220, 222, 224, and the robust 444, represents a lineage of heavy-duty garden and compact utility tractors. Produced from the mid-1970s through the late 1980s, these machines are renowned for their exceptional durability, featuring cast iron components and heavy-gauge steel frames. Engineered for demanding property maintenance, they offer significant versatility through features like powerful PTO systems and hydraulic lift capabilities, making them ideal for homeowners with substantial grounds, small farms, and groundskeepers. Their design philosophy prioritized longevity and over-engineered construction, setting them apart from many contemporary consumer-grade tractors.
